Output 3468faa2aa0a2b4c80298e530d941ee835dc34d966adca0f8b3473c7648f05ae:2

value
11192298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f69eed9ed93e99e5c6ae8828d35c99db1cc365 OP_EQUAL
address
33RHXWbythBvZUzsHX9wYBRhAqtkRgQqTC
transaction
3468faa2aa0a2b4c80298e530d941ee835dc34d966adca0f8b3473c7648f05ae
confirmations
13145
spent
true